PDA

View Full Version : [PHP/AJAX] Web Chat Stile Facebook


rewind176
05-05-2011, 10:49
Ciao a tutti, il mio quesito è molto semplice: vorrei realizzare una chat-web stile quella di facebook, so che è basata sul protocollo XMPP e fin qui ok.. non riesco a capire una cosa però!
analizzando con firebug ho notato che quando scrivi o invii un messaggio , il client invia due chiamate sincrone ad altrettante funzioni php. Fin qui ok ma alla ricezione dei messaggi il browser non effettua nessuna richiesta .. quindi come caspita fa il browser a ricevere il testo del messaggio di una persona, se non effettua una chiamata? Si dovrà per forza mettere in ascolto con qualcosa.. o no??

grazie!

Ludo237
05-05-2011, 15:10
io ne avevo realizzata una simile però in C++ e file txt
ogni volta che un utente x apriva il client in C++ visualizzava a video i client connessi (nella rete locale) ogni volta che sceglievi un client per chattare si creava un foglio di testo (nominato data_ora_clientx_clienty) e li si salvavano le conversazioni..

penso che una cosa analoga si possa fare in php jquery, con l'ausilio di Ajax..

]Rik`[
06-05-2011, 12:43
ma la chat di fb non è in Erlang?